Year 10 Science Investigation

On Tuesday 21 May the Year 10 Science students began their first long term investigation for the year into the intricacies of chemical reactions and rates.

Students individually designed their investigative technique then embarked on a systematic trial and redesign process developing and refining their experiment to collect the necessary data to prove or disprove their stated hypothesis.

Students creativity and engineering skills were displayed throughout the three individual classes and their Scientific analytical and design skills were put to the test. The development of “true” research and scientific investigative experiences is integral to the Science curriculum here at Peter Carnley Anglican Community School.
